社区
C#
帖子详情
有没有NHibernate的配置和使用介绍
xiezhi
2004-11-10 05:45:06
中文的最好,有示例就更好!
好象现在这方面资料特别少。
...全文
250
6
打赏
收藏
有没有NHibernate的配置和使用介绍
中文的最好,有示例就更好! 好象现在这方面资料特别少。
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
sutalon
2005-03-01
打赏
举报
回复
顶
xiezhi
2004-11-29
打赏
举报
回复
顶啊顶~
river723
2004-11-19
打赏
举报
回复
http://community.csdn.net/Expert/topic/3517/3517657.xml?temp=5.642337E-02
里面有很多关于NHibernate的讨论
xiezhi
2004-11-19
打赏
举报
回复
ding!
xiezhi
2004-11-15
打赏
举报
回复
是我想要的,不过看起来还是晕忽忽的!
rgbcn
2004-11-13
打赏
举报
回复
看看这个!不知道是不是你要的!
http://www.cnblogs.com/ezwyj/archive/2004/11/09/62083.html
实现
NHibernate
配置
的三种实现方法
有三种方式来存放
nhibernate
的
配置
1. 作为单独的一节放在相应程序的
配置
文件中,对于执行文件或类库为文件名称后加.config,对于asp.net则是放在web.config中。这种方式必须在
配置
文件的configSetions中声明
nhibernate
的
配置
节,
配置
内容由Cfg.Environment类来读取,该类所有成员均为静态的,另外它还定义了
配置
中key值的常数。
2. 放在一个单独的
配置
文件中,默认为hibernate.cfg.xml,
使用
时必须调用Cfg.Configuration.Config()。如不是默认的
配置
文件名,还必须指明
配置
文件名称。这种方式最适合多数据库的情况,可以为每个数据库建立一个
配置
文件。
3. 手工在程序中加入,
配置
内容最后将加入到Cfg.Configuration.Properties属性中,此属性为一IDictionary对象,并且为public。
________________________________________________________
总共有三个项目,分别保存在三个不同的文件中,上述三中方法的实现分别放在文件名为
NHibernate
SampleA、
NHibernate
SampleX、
NHibernate
SampleC的三个文件中。
注意:如果要运行源程序,则要更改数据库的
配置
路径。
NHibernate
配置
的过程.pdf
NHibernate
配置
的过程.pdf
NHibernate
配置
的过程.pdf
Dapper从入门到精通
Dapper是一个适用于.NET平台、轻量级的ORM框架,在性能方面拥有微型ORM之王的美誉,几乎与原生ADO.NET数据读取器一样快,如果你在小的项目中
使用
Entity Framework、
NHibernate
等框架来处理大数据访问及关系映射,未免有点杀鸡用牛刀,你又觉得ORM省时省力,这时Dapper 将是你不二的选择。 Dapper是国外大型IT问答社区StackOverFlow最早开发并开源的,Dapper的源代码放在github上托管,并且可以用NuGet方式添加到项目中,Dapper的r支持多表并联的对象,支持一对多、多对多的关系,支持原生sql与模型对象混合写法,易学易用,无XML无属性,代码以前怎么写现在还怎么写。
NHibernate
3.2例子 用
配置
文件和不有
配置
文件
NHibernate
3.2源程序,还带例子源程序,都是从网上找的,原带的用
配置
文件hibernate.cfg.xml实来现。DiPiPiDemo的实现不用hibernate.cfg.xml
配置
文件,这样可以把
配置
放到任何地方,还可以加密。很有用处。
NHibernate
实体类和
配置
文件生成模板
CodeSimith
NHibernate
实体类和
配置
文件生成模板
C#
110,533
社区成员
642,574
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章